Sat 1312488480744754

decimal
314995.980744754
degree
0°104995′499″980744754‴
percentile
62.49945153278533%
name
eoacauepkpb
cycle
0
epoch
1
period
156
block
314995
offset
980744754
timestamp
rarity
common